Reinforce Buttonhole
When sewing buttonholes on stretch fabric or coat fabric, hook a filler cord under the buttonhole foot. The filler cord is guided along with the buttonhole foot. Mercerized yarn or fine crochet thread is suitable as a filler cord.
- Fit the buttonhole foot with slide.
- Pull out the button holder plate and insert the button.
- Hang the thread over the hook behind the presser foot and then lay it over the presser foot.
- Hook both ends of the thread on the front of the presser foot, guide them into the groove and tie them together temporarily.
- Adjust the stitch length and stitch width.
- Lower the presser foot.
- Press the buttonhole lever all the way down and press it backwards slightly until it clicks in position.
- Use the foot control to start sewing.
- The buttonhole will sew over the cord, covering it.
- Pull the cord loop until the loop disappears in the bartack.
- Pull the ends of the cord through to the wrong side of the fabric (using a hand stitching-needle), knot or secure with stitches.
